METROLPOLITAN OPERA on 91.5 WFSQ-FM
Sundays, 1pm - 5pm

Launched in 1931, the Metropolitan Opera’s Saturday matinee broadcasts are the longest-running continuous classical program in radio history. The 81st season kicks off on December 3, 2011, with Handel’s  Rodelinda, starring Renée Fleming, Stephanie Blythe, and Andreas Scholl. Twenty-three broadcasts will be presented on the Toll Brothers–Metropolitan Opera International Radio Network through May 5, 2012. Margaret Juntwait returns as the series’s host for her eighth season, joined by commentator Ira Siff.
